How Wide Is A Hallway In Feet . Some argue that it should be 42 inches to feel more comfortable. For instance, if the corridor is only meant as a passage, a width of 36 inches is enough. The standard commercial hallway width should be no littler than 36 inches—this is an ideal estimation for little houses. The width of your hallway can vary, depending on how you will use it. The ada requires a minimum hallway width of 36 in (91.4 cm) for residential spaces and 44 in (111.8 cm) for commercial spaces to accommodate wheelchair users and those with mobility challenges. The width of a hallway depends on the building’s purpose, but typically, a minimum width of 4 feet (1.2 meters) is recommended. The standard minimum size of a hallway is 36 inches wide. For residential structures, the stipulated minimum width for a hallway is set at 36 inches, which equates to 3 feet.
